5 / 25 page 5 Rev M 2/22/2007 SP3080E-3088E Advanced RS485 Transceivers © Copyright 2007 Sipex Corporation ELECTRICAL CHARACTERISTICS PARAMETER TEST CONDITIONS MIN TYP MAX UNIT Digital Input Signals: DI, DE, RE Logic input thresholds High, VIH 2.0 V Low, VIL 0.8 Logic Input Current TA = 25°C, after first transition ±1 µA Input Hysteresis TA = 25°C 100 mV Driver Differential Driver Output (VOD) No Load VCC V Differential Driver Output, Test 1 RL=100Ω (RS-422) 2 VCC V RL=54Ω (RS-485) 1.5 2.7 VCC Differential Driver Output, Test 2 VCM = -7 to +12V 1.5 VCC Change in Magnitude of Differential Output Voltage (∆VOD) (Note 1) RL=54 or 100Ω ±0.2 V Driver Common Mode Output Voltage (Vcc) RL=54 or 100Ω 1 3 V Change in Common Mode Output Voltage (∆VOC) RL=54 or 100Ω ±0.2 V Driver Short Circuit Current Limit -7V ≤ VOUT ≤ +12V ±250 mA Output Leakage Current (Full-duplex versions, Y & Z pins) Note 2 DE=0, VOUT=12V 125 µA RE=0, VCC=0 or 5.5V VOUT= -7V -100 Receiver Receiver Input Resistance -7V ≤ VCM ≤ 12V 96 KΩ Input Current (A, B pins) DE=0, RE=0, Vcc=0 or 5.5V VIN= 12V 125 VIN= -7V -100 µA Receiver Differential Threshold (VA-VB) -7V ≤ VCM ≤ 12V -200 -125 -40 mV Receiver Input Hysteresis 25 mV Receiver Output Voltage VOH IOUT = -8mA, VID = -40mV Vcc-1.5 V VOL IOUT = 8mA, VID = -200mV 0.4 High-Z Receiver Output Current VCC =5.5V, 0 ≤ VOUT ≤ VCC ± 1 µA Receiver Output Short Circuit Current 0V ≤ VRO ≤ VCC ± 95 mA Supply and Protection Supply Current IQ, Active Mode No load, DI=0 or VCC 400 900 µA Shutdown Mode DE=0, RE=Vcc, DI=VCC 1 µA Thermal Shutdown Temperature Junction temperature 165 o C Thermal Shutdown Hysteresis 15 Notes: 1. Change in Magnitude of Differential Output Voltage and Change in Magnitude of Common Mode Output Voltage are the changes in output voltage when DI input changes state. 2. Except devices which don’t have DE or RE inputs. 3. The transceivers are put into shutdown by bringing RE high and DE low. If the inputs are in this state for less than 50ns the device does not enter shutdown. If the enable inputs are held in this state for at least 600ns the device is assured to be in shutdown. In this low power mode most circuitry is disabled and supply current is typically 1nA. 4.Characterized, not 100% tested. |
